Angola deprived of 60 percent of oil revenues – President
27 June 2016, Luanda — Angola failed to raise 60% of oil generated foreign currency earnings for State Budget due to the global sharp price drop of product, said Wednesday in eastern Moxico province the head of State, José Eduardo dos Santos.
